Zsuzsa KeskenyZsuzsa Keskeny
We were really struggling to find a good pizza for lunch in Olbia close to our hotel, so we were quite happy when Google popped up this place for us. All the waiters are kind and friendly, super attentive and also considering special wishes regarding the food. Several options for vegetarians or even vegans as well. Lunch is until 3 pm, dinner is from 7 pm. The restaurant is at the beach and the view is great. We enjoyed the food and the service so much, we went back for several days in a row during our stay.
